The Sailboat Model: Your Toolkit for Resilience

Research into emotional well-being often points toward a framework called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T). It sounds clinical, but there’s a beautiful analogy used within it called the Sailboat Model. Think of your life as a boat navigating the vast, sometimes choppy, ocean of the 2020s. To keep moving toward your "Future Vision," you need a few key components:

1. The Sail (Mindfulness)

Mindfulness is your sail. It’s what catches the wind and keeps you present. In the queer community, we are often hyper-vigilant: always checking our surroundings for safety. Mindfulness helps us steer that energy back to ourselves. It’s about noticing the sun on your skin or the way a particularly good gay romance novel makes your heart flutter. Staying present counteracts the anxiety of "what if" and the weight of "what was."

2. The Anchor (Distress Tolerance)

When the storm gets too loud, you need an anchor. Distress tolerance is the ability to sit with uncomfortable emotions without spiraling. This might look like grounding exercises, or: let’s be real: it might look like disappearing into a steamy MM romance to give your brain a much-needed break. It’s about self-soothing until the tide turns.

3. The Rudder (Emotion Regulation)

The rudder guides you. Instead of letting your emotions toss you around, you use tools like gratitude or creative expression to steer. Maybe you write your own stories, or maybe you find solace in the best MM romance books of 2026 that reflect your own lived experiences.

4. The Crew (Community)

No one sails alone. Your crew is your community. Whether it’s an online gay book club, a local pride group, or the authors you follow on social media, these connections are foundational to our resilience.

Envisioning the Queer Future Through Literature

Why do we talk so much about gay novels and MM fiction when we’re discussing resilience? Because stories are blueprints.

When we read a slow burn MM romance or an enemies to lovers epic, we aren't just looking for a "happily ever after." We are witnessing characters overcome obstacles, navigate identity, and find love in a world that wasn't always built for them. That is the definition of building hope.

In 2026, we’re seeing a massive surge in queer fantasy romance and gay contemporary romance that doesn’t just focus on the struggle, but on the joy. By seeing ourselves represented in high-stakes adventures or cozy, domestic settings, we are mentally rehearsing our own futures. We are saying, "If they can have a world where they are safe and loved, why can't I?"
